The SECURE®-C Cervical Artificial Disc is a motion-sparing technology designed as an alternative to fusion. Through its unique selectively constrained design, SECURE®-C is designed to allow up to ±15° motion in flexion-extension and up to ±10° motion in lateral bending. The design is intended to allow unlimited axial rotation and to permit sagittal plane translation of ±1.25mm.
